Nestled in the heart of Papeete, Bougainville Park serves as a serene, tropical retreat amidst the city's hustle and bustle. Stretching from Boulevard Pomare to Rue du General de Gaulle, this lush haven is perfect for a leisurely picnic or grabbing a bite from the local roulettes. Traveling with little ones? They’ll have a blast at the playground. Plus, the park often hosts vibrant floral, cultural, and artistic displays that captivate visitors.
For those interested in local culture, the park is named after the famous French explorer Louis Antoine de Bougainville, who circumnavigated the globe in the 18th century. It's a spot where history and nature beautifully intertwine, offering a unique glimpse into Tahiti's past.
